Why Tracking Your Workouts Matters

Consistent workout tracking is the single most reliable way to ensure progressive overload. Without a record of what you lifted last week, you risk stalling or overtraining. Studies show that individuals who log their training improve adherence by over 30% compared to those who don't. Tracking allows you to see exactly when to increase weight by 2.5 kg or add an extra rep to each set.

Three primary methods dominate the fitness world: a physical notebook, a dedicated fitness app, and a spreadsheet. Each has distinct strengths and weaknesses depending on your training style, tech comfort, and need for data analysis. This article compares them across five key criteria: ease of use, data depth, portability, long-term analysis, and cost.

Notebook: Simple and Uninterrupted

A notebook requires no battery, no Wi-Fi, and no app updates. You open it, write your warm-up sets of 20 kg for 3x12, then your working sets of 50 kg for 4x8. Many lifters find the physical act of writing reinforces memory and focus. You can also sketch exercise variations or note how a set felt without character limits.

The downside: no automatic calculations. If you want to know your total weekly volume (sets x reps x weight), you manually sum each entry. For a 5-day split with 15 sets per day, that's 75 calculations per week. Over a 12-week mesocycle, that becomes tedious. Also, notebooks are easy to misplace and don't back up. If you spill water on your gym bag, that month of data is gone.

For lifters who prefer minimalism and a distraction-free environment, a simple spiral notebook costing under $5 remains a top choice. It forces you to be present and deliberate.

Spreadsheet: Maximum Data Control

A spreadsheet, whether in Google Sheets or Excel, offers the most analytical power. You can create columns for date, exercise, weight, sets, reps, RPE, and notes. With formulas, you can automatically calculate volume load: for a squat session of 100 kg for 5x5, volume = 100 x 5 x 5 = 2500 kg. You can also track trend lines for your 1RM estimates over 6 to 12 months.

One major advantage: you can build custom dashboards. For example, you can create a sheet that shows your bench press progress over the last 16 weeks, including deload weeks. You can also share it with a coach who can leave feedback in a comments column.

The trade-off is setup time. Building a robust spreadsheet may take 2 to 3 hours initially. You also need a device to edit it — typically a laptop or tablet. While mobile apps exist, entering data on a phone screen during a workout is slower than writing in a notebook or tapping in a dedicated app. For data-driven athletes who love numbers, spreadsheets are unmatched.

Fitness Apps: Convenience and Automation

Fitness apps like Strong, Hevy, or JEFIT provide a middle ground. They offer pre-built templates for popular programs such as 5/3/1, Starting Strength, or PPL splits. You tap to log a set, and the app automatically calculates rest timers, volume, and estimated 1RM. For example, after logging 80 kg for 3 sets of 5 reps, the app might estimate your 1RM at 90 kg using the Epley formula.

Most apps sync to cloud storage, so your data is safe if you switch phones. They also include built-in timers, progress charts, and often a social feed for sharing PRs. The best apps let you export data to CSV, giving you spreadsheet-level analysis if desired.

However, apps can be distracting. Notification pings from other apps can break concentration. Many also require a subscription — $5 to $15 per month — for full features like custom routines or advanced analytics. For the average gym-goer who wants plug-and-play convenience and automatic progress tracking, a fitness app is the most efficient choice.

Comparing Long-Term Data Analysis

Long-term analysis separates serious athletes from casual trainees. After 6 months of training, you should be able to answer: Did my squat 1RM increase by at least 10%? Did my bench press volume plateau in weeks 8 through 12? Spreadsheets excel here — you can create a pivot table to compare volume by exercise across months. Apps often show basic line charts but may limit historical data to 12 months on free tiers.

Notebooks require manual review. You'd flip through pages to compare your squat numbers from January vs June. That's doable but time-consuming. A 6-month notebook with 180 entries might take 30 minutes to review manually.

If you're serious about periodization, you need a system that lets you look back at least 16 weeks of data to spot trends in fatigue and recovery. A spreadsheet gives you that power without the guesswork.

For most lifters, a combo approach works: use an app during workouts for quick logging, then export to a spreadsheet for monthly analysis. This gives you the best of both worlds.

Cost and Accessibility Considerations

Notebooks are the cheapest — a high-quality A5 grid notebook costs $8 to $15 and lasts 4 to 6 months. Spreadsheets are free if you use Google Sheets, but you need a device. A basic smartphone works, but comfortable data entry usually requires a laptop or tablet, which adds cost if you don't already own one.

Fitness apps range from free (limited features) to $10/month for premium. Over a year, that's $120. Some apps offer lifetime purchase options around $40 to $60. Compare that to a notebook at $20 per year and you see a clear price difference. However, the time saved in manual calculations and automatic rest timers may justify the subscription for time-pressed individuals.

Accessibility also matters: notebooks work anywhere, even in a power outage. Apps require a charged phone and often internet access. If you train in a basement gym with poor signal, offline-capable apps or a notebook become essential.

Practical Recommendation for Lifters

Choose based on your training goals and environment. For a beginner running a simple linear progression (e.g., add 2.5 kg each session), a notebook is perfect. Write down: date, exercise, weight, sets, reps. That's all you need for the first 8 to 12 weeks.

For intermediate to advanced lifters using periodized programs (e.g., 5/3/1 with joker sets, or a DUP template with varying intensities), an app or spreadsheet is better. The app handles complex rest timers and percentage calculations. For example, in week 3 of a 5/3/1 cycle, you need to calculate 85%, 90%, and 95% of your training max. An app does that instantly.

If you coach others or analyze your data deeply, invest time in a spreadsheet. It gives you the flexibility to track RPE, sleep, and nutrition alongside lifts. No single method is superior for everyone. Test each for two weeks and stick with the one that keeps you consistent.
